Introduction of the TCF Test
The Purchase TCF Exam is created by the French Ministry of Education and is commonly recognized by organizations and organizations that need proof of French language proficiency. The test assesses prospects in several areas, consisting of listening comprehension, checking out understanding, spoken expression, and written expression.

The online registration procedure for the TCF test normally follows a series of straightforward steps. Here is a comprehensive guide:
Step-by-Step Registration Process
Choose the Right Platform: The initial step is to visit the official website of the company administering the TCF Exam Booking test in your region, such as France Education International (FEI) or your regional French cultural center.
Select Your Test Date: Review the readily available test dates and choose one that finest fits your schedule.
Create an Account: If you are a first-time registrant, produce an account on the platform. You will require to provide individual info, such as your name, date of birth, e-mail address, and possibly your citizenship.
Total the Registration Form: Fill in the registration type with the needed information, including your chosen test center, test date, and any unique accommodations you may require.
Publish Identification Documents: Most registration platforms will require you to upload a valid identification document (passport, nationwide ID, etc). Make sure the document is clear and clear.
Payment: Proceed to the payment area. The charges for the TCF test may differ by location and company, so be prepared to pay online via credit/debit card or other accepted payment approaches.
Verification: After finishing the payment, you will get a confirmation e-mail with your registration details. Keep this e-mail for your records.
Get ready for the Test: Utilize the time before your test date to study and practice. Lots of platforms offer official practice products, sample concerns, and tips for success.

What is the cost of the TCF test?
The expense varies by location and test center. On average, fees v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 200. Inspect the specific site for precise pricing.
2. For how long does it require to get test results?
Outcomes are normally offered within 2 to 4 weeks after the test date. Prospects will get a certificate that information their scores and proficiency level.
3. Can I alter my test date after registration?
The majority of test centers allow candidates to alter their test dates, however it frequently comes with a cost. Examine the specific policies of your screening center.
4. What documents do I require for registration?
You will normally require a valid ID (passport or nationwide ID) and potentially extra documentation depending on your location.
5. Is the TCF test available online?
While the registration procedure is online, the TCF test itself is normally conducted in-person at authorized screening centers.
